Key Engine Types

BMW produces a variety of engines, each with its own characteristics and reliability profiles. Here are some of the most notable:


  • Inline-6 Engines: Often regarded as the pinnacle of BMW engineering, these engines are known for their smoothness and reliability. Models like the M54 and N52 have earned a reputation for longevity.

  • Inline-4 Engines: While these engines are lighter and more fuel-efficient, they can sometimes lack the robustness of their inline-6 counterparts. The N20 engine, for example, has had mixed reviews regarding reliability.

  • V8 Engines: Found in models like the M60 and N63, these engines offer incredible performance but can be prone to issues, particularly with oil leaks and cooling problems.

Common Reliability Issues

While BMW engines are generally well-engineered, they are not immune to problems. Here are some common issues that can arise:


  1. Cooling System Failures: Many BMW engines suffer from cooling system failures, leading to overheating. This is particularly common in older models.

  2. Oil Leaks: Oil leaks can be a persistent problem, especially in V8 engines. Gaskets and seals tend to wear out over time, leading to costly repairs.

  3. Timing Chain Issues: Certain models, especially those with the N20 engine, have reported timing chain tensioner failures, which can lead to catastrophic engine damage.

Top Contenders for Reliability

When it comes to BMW engines that have stood the test of time, a few specific models consistently rise to the top. Here’s a rundown of the most reliable BMW engines:


  • M54 Inline-6: This engine is often hailed as one of the best BMW engines ever made. Found in models like the E46 3 Series and E39 5 Series, the M54 is celebrated for its durability and smooth operation. It can easily surpass 200,000 miles with proper maintenance.

  • N52 Inline-6: Another inline-6 that deserves mention, the N52 powers a range of models including the E90 3 Series. While it has some issues with the cooling system, it’s generally reliable and provides a great balance of performance and efficiency.

  • M57 Diesel Engine: Known for its longevity, the M57 diesel engine is found in various BMW models. Diesel engines are typically more robust, and the M57 is no exception. With proper care, it can run well beyond 300,000 miles.

  • S54 Inline-6: Found in the M3 E46, this engine is not only powerful but also reliable when maintained correctly. It has a strong following due to its performance and durability.

Engines to Approach with Caution

While there are engines that shine in reliability, some models have garnered a reputation for issues. Here’s a list of engines that may raise red flags:


  1. N63 V8: This engine is known for its performance but has been plagued by oil leaks and cooling system failures. If you’re considering a model with this engine, be prepared for potential maintenance costs.

  2. N20 Inline-4: The N20 has been criticized for timing chain issues, which can lead to catastrophic engine failure if not addressed promptly. It’s a great engine for performance but demands vigilance.

  3. N62 V8: While it offers decent power, the N62 is known for various issues, including oil leaks and cooling problems. Owners should keep an eye on these aspects to avoid costly repairs.

Comparative Reliability Ratings

To better understand the reliability of different BMW engines, here’s a comprehensive table that summarizes their performance and common issues:


























































Engine Type Model Years Reliability Rating (1-10) Common Problems Longevity Potential
M54 Inline-6 2000-2006 9 Minor oil leaks, cooling issues 200,000+ miles
N52 Inline-6 2006-2015 8 Cooling system failures 150,000-200,000 miles
M57 Diesel 2000-2010 9 None significant 300,000+ miles
S54 Inline-6 2000-2006 8 Minor oil leaks 150,000-200,000 miles
N63 V8 2008-2018 5 Oil leaks, cooling issues 100,000-150,000 miles
N20 Inline-4 2011-2017 6 Timing chain issues 100,000-150,000 miles
N62 V8 2002-2010 5 Oil leaks, cooling issues 100,000-150,000 miles
